Chapter 13 - Multiple Integration - 13.2 Double Integrals over General Regions - 13.2 Exercises - Page 980: 7

Answer

\[\int_{0}^{2}{\int_{{{x}^{3}}}^{4x}{dy}dx}\]

Work Step by Step

\[\begin{align} & \text{From the graph, the region }R\text{ is} \\ & R=\left\{ \left( x,y \right):{{x}^{3}}\le y\le 4x,0\le x\le 2 \right\} \\ & \text{Then,} \\ & \int_{0}^{2}{\int_{{{x}^{3}}}^{4x}{dy}dx} \\ \end{align}\]
